Sourcing guidance for Linear Displacement Sensors

What are the key technical specifications to consider when selecting a linear displacement sensor?

Buyers must prioritize Measurement Range (Stroke Length) to ensure it covers the full movement of the machinery. Linearity Accuracy is critical; for industrial automation, a linearity of ±0.05% to ±0.1% is standard. Additionally, consider the Output Signal (e.g., 4-20mA, 0-10V, or digital RS485/SSI) to ensure compatibility with your PLC or control system.

How do I choose between different sensor technologies like LVDT, Potentiometric, and Magnetostrictive?

Potentiometric sensors are cost-effective for simple applications but have a limited lifespan due to mechanical wear. LVDT (Linear Variable Differential Transformer) offers frictionless operation and high durability, ideal for harsh environments. Magnetostrictive sensors provide non-contact, high-precision measurement and are preferred for long-stroke hydraulic cylinders where long-term reliability is paramount.

What environmental protection standards are necessary for industrial displacement sensors?

For outdoor or heavy industrial use, ensure the sensor has an IP67 or IP68 rating to protect against dust and water ingress. If the sensor is used in hydraulic systems, verify the Pressure Rating (typically up to 350-600 bar). For hazardous zones, look for ATEX or Ex-proof certifications to ensure operational safety.

What role does resolution and repeatability play in procurement?

Resolution defines the smallest change the sensor can detect; for high-precision CNC or medical equipment, sub-micron resolution is often required. Repeatability ensures the sensor provides the same reading under identical conditions; look for values within ±0.01mm to maintain process consistency and quality control.

Cross-Border Sourcing & Risk Management for Precision Sensors

What are the risks associated with shipping sensitive electronic sensors internationally?

Linear sensors are precision instruments sensitive to electrostatic discharge (ESD) and mechanical shock. Ensure the supplier uses anti-static packaging and shock-absorbent foam. For long-distance sea freight, confirm the use of desiccants to prevent moisture corrosion of internal circuitry.

How should I negotiate pricing and lead times for bulk sensor orders?

B2B buyers can typically negotiate a 10-20% discount for quantities exceeding 100 units. Discuss tiered pricing based on annual volume. Regarding lead times, standard sensors usually ship in 7-15 days, but customized stroke lengths or specialized connectors may require 4-6 weeks; always include a penalty clause for late delivery in the purchase agreement.
